A Director at Titan International (TWI) is Buying Shares


Today, a Director at Titan International (NYSE: TWI), Maurice Taylor, bought shares of TWI for $720K.

This recent transaction increases Maurice Taylor’s holding in the company by 22.23% to a total of $4 million. Following Maurice Taylor’s last TWI Buy transaction on November 09, 2015, the stock climbed by 2.6%.

Based on Titan International’s latest earnings report for the quarter ending June 30, the company posted quarterly revenue of $429 million and quarterly net profit of $1.02 million. In comparison, last year the company earned revenue of $364 million and had a GAAP net loss of $10.33 million. Currently, Titan International has an average volume of 488K.

Six different firms, including Feltl and Jefferies, currently also have a Buy rating on the stock.

Titan International, Inc. is a holding company, which engages in the manufacture of wheels, tires, and undercarriage industrial. It operates through the following segments: Agricultural, Earthmoving and Construction, and Consumer.
